°®¶¹´«Ã½ researchers to play key role in making Tampa roads safer
Researchers from the University of South °®¶¹´«Ã½ are partnering with the City of Tampa to develop innovative solutions that will lead to safer travel conditions along busy roads within the city. The initiative stems from a new $2.6 million grant from the U.S. Department of Transportation received by the city and announced by Tampa Mayor Jane Castor.

°®¶¹´«Ã½ receives $17M federal grant to help boost railroad workforce
The University of South °®¶¹´«Ã½ has been awarded a $17 million grant from the Federal Railroad Administration’s (FRA) Consolidated Rail Infrastructure and Safety Improvement program.
